Girvan Youth Under 13s won 6-2 in another fine display this time against Auchinleck Talbot Under 13s.

The ever improving young Girvan side continued their fine start to their first season against a decent Auchinleck Talbot side.

The home team opened the scoring after 15 minutes following some good play from Greg McCartney, who made a fine run before slotting home from 12 yards.

Number two followed five minutes later after another good passing move from the home side. Girvan’s Jordon Brown played a slide rule pass to Morgan Orr, who in turn set up Callum Skilling to slot the ball under the oncoming Auchinleck keeper.

The visitors upped their game after the early setback which saw them pull a goal back after 30 minutes when their striker headed home from a well delivered corner kick.

Girvan continued to play with confidence, stroking the ball about well which led to them restoring their two goal advantage on the stroke of half time when Morgan Orr lashed the ball home from eight yards.

The home side continued the goal rush in the second half when Sean Millarvie struck early doors to give the youngsters a three goal cushion before Dylan Moore slotted home a Lewis Gibson cross for number five.

Kai Poole rounded off Girvan’s scoring before Talbot pulled a goal back in the dying minutes of the game. The management, coach and boys would like to thank all the sponsors for their new kits.
